Output de44bb564f5258e6593cb39f50c02419786908e0107c47510fc03fc618455518:3

value
19668
script pubkey
OP_0 OP_PUSHBYTES_20 a7643f25a6bfb2c95e572baeef1b262228f8a9f2
address
bc1q5ajr7fdxh7evjhjh9whw7xexyg50320je42fu5
transaction
de44bb564f5258e6593cb39f50c02419786908e0107c47510fc03fc618455518
confirmations
76748
spent
true